Lammer Law
The Lammer Law was built in Canada by owner/designer Duncan Muirhead in 1980. She and her sister ship Cuan Law are the world's largest trimarans. At 93 feet long on deck by 42 feet wide, her size, shallow draft, and the tri-hull design provide extreme stability, both at anchor and underway. MORE...
